Q. Due to the impossibly high cut-offs this year, I have taken admission in BA (Hons) history although my heart was set on pursuing psychology. Can you please tell me if there’s any way I can pursue a bachelor’s degree from another university along with my present course?

A. Oh yes you can…! To enhance the career prospects of many students like you, the UGC has approved a proposal to allow students to pursue two degree programmes simultaneously.

This is such a welcome move. For all practical purposes, even an engineering student can now pursue a degree in economics or any other subject for that matter. However, since a minimum attendance ow criterion is attached to regular degree programmes, the second degree must be via Open & Distance Learning (ODL) or Online mode.

So, you’re now free to pursue two degrees in different streams as well as from different institutions. Else, you can opt for pursuing both from the same institution, provided it offers multiple modes of learning.

The detailed guidelines will be notified shortly.
